About our branches
Our branches are local hubs of support, conversation, and community. Every branch operates independently, shaped by its members and tailored to meet local needs. While some hold regular social meetups, others focus on information sharing, support, and newsletters.
We believe that lived experience is powerful and our branches are led by people who truly understand life after polio and life with PPS. Whether you’re newly diagnosed, supporting someone who is, or have been living with the effects of polio for decades, there’s a place for you.
Most branches offer:
- Social events and outings
- Information sessions
- Peer support and discussion groups
